Is your vet open today? I'd get her in ASAP. This could be debris implanted in the eye or a corneal scratch - which is extremely painful. Normal eye infections involve some redness, goopiness, discharge, even some smelliness. BUT, when a dog is trying to keep it's eye closed due to discomfort - I'd err on the side of getting her in ASAP - bc not only could you be risking terrible damage - but eye pain can be excruciating. Hopefully, it's nothing - but normally (normally), dogs don't squint or try to keep their eyes closed with just a bacterial infection.
